## Changelog 3.8.0 — Circuit breaker defaults

For this week's sync: we tightened the Farrow gateway's circuit breaker around the upstream Tidewell API. Failure threshold drops from 50% to 20%, and the half-open probe window shortens considerably, based on last month's incident review. The new default values shipped in 3.8.0 are listed below.

config for haweg-bagag:
[kasath]
host = kasath.qirvancorp.internal
user = kasath_svc
database = kasath_prod

**Alert: doclint-failure-rate-high**

Fires when Quillcheck rejects more than 30% of doc builds over 15 minutes. Usually means a rule update broke existing pages, not author error. Check the latest ruleset merge first; revert if it landed within the window. Triage steps and the rule changelog are here:

operations page: https://jenkins.zemvarcloud.local/job/merge_requests/repo/build/73930b4b30f0a8ed

Fan-out backpressure for the Quillet notifier: when the queue depth crosses the soft limit, the dispatcher sheds low-priority pushes and batches the rest at 500ms intervals. Reviewer should confirm the shed counter is exported and that retries respect the jitter window. Once merged, the release artifact gets re-signed by the pipeline, which expects the deploy key shown below.

deploy key for bawep-yawif: bky6_GQhaSt

Deploy step: Vendoring third-party fonts (Project Inkmoth)

Before this week's release, the Inkmoth build now vendors all third-party fonts instead of pulling them at runtime from the Glyphbarrow CDN. Run `inkmoth fonts vendor` during the deploy, which fetches the licensed families into `assets/fonts/` and writes a lockfile. The fetch step authenticates against the Glyphbarrow mirror, so the deploy host's env file must be updated first. Add the mirror access token to that file on a single line, as shown below.

vault entry, kagep-yajeg: COURIER_KEY5=da097

## Deploying the Gatewick Proctor Queue

Deploys are pretty painless: push to main, wait for the pipeline, then watch the queue drain dashboard for five minutes. If candidates pile up mid-exam, roll back first and ask questions later — the queue replays safely. Everything the workers care about lives in one config block, shown here for reference.

settings of bafof-yagef:
JOROX_PIN=8740
JOROX_TENANT=pelox
JOROX_METRICS_HOST=metrics.jorox.qorvelworks.internal
JOROX_SEAL=seal_c78f63c1
JOROX_STANDBY_TEAM=norax